Abstract

Provided is a Fe—Al-based alloy vibration-damping component including 4.0 to 12.0% by mass of Al with the balance being Fe and inevitable impurities, having an average crystal grain size in the range of over 700 μm to 2,000 μm and a sectional defect rate of lower than 0.1%, and having an irregular sectional shape. Also provided is a method for manufacturing a Fe—Al-based alloy vibration-damping component. The method obtains a vibration-damping component having an irregular sectional shape, and includes a shaping step in which metal powder including 4.0 to 12.0% by mass of Al with the balance being Fe and inevitable impurities is melted and solidified using a heat source with a scanning rate set to 700 to 1700 mm/second to obtain a shaped product and an annealing step in which the shaped product is annealed at a temperature of 800 to 1200° C.
